Output e3d8e8326ec7a836469404435126d9547478d8f81a20504f8f0b3ea589a64426:0

value
758278
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e45ac6c6661dd8c19a4bcd4a0a66f5b4e59d6100 OP_EQUALVERIFY OP_CHECKSIG
address
1MpRozorJpsrWRNU8dbsaXFN2D8ycyDCgP
transaction
e3d8e8326ec7a836469404435126d9547478d8f81a20504f8f0b3ea589a64426
confirmations
593112
spent
true